What is Commercial Solar?

Commercial solar refers to solar power systems installed on commercial or industrial properties to offset the energy consumption of a business. Unlike smaller residential systems, commercial solar panels are typically larger, more powerful, and tailored to meet the high energy demands of businesses.

A standard commercial solar system can range from 10kW to several hundred kilowatts, depending on the size of the property and its energy usage.


Why Choose Commercial Solar in Sydney?

Sydney boasts high solar irradiance levels, making it an excellent location for solar power generation. Businesses in Sydney can take full advantage of the sun, reducing their reliance on the grid and lowering operational costs.

Here are a few compelling reasons to consider commercial solar in Sydney:

  • Abundant Sunshine: Sydney receives an average of 4.5 to 6 peak sun hours per day.
  • Rising Energy Prices: Electricity costs for commercial users are on the rise, making solar more financially attractive.
  • Sustainability Goals: Installing solar aligns with ESG (Environmental, Social, and Governance) goals and corporate sustainability strategies.
  • Government Incentives: Businesses can claim tax benefits and receive Small-scale Technology Certificates (STCs) to reduce upfront installation costs.

Key Benefits of Solar for Commercial Use

1. Significant Cost Savings

By installing commercial solar panels, businesses can reduce their electricity bills by up to 60–80%. The payback period is typically between 3 to 5 years, after which energy savings go straight to your bottom line.

2. Improved Energy Independence

Solar power reduces your reliance on the national grid and shields your business from future price hikes.

3. Environmental Impact

Using clean, renewable energy significantly reduces your business’s carbon footprint. It also enhances your brand image among environmentally conscious clients and investors.

4. Asset Value Increase

A building with a solar power system can attract tenants or buyers who value low operating costs and sustainability.

5. Low Maintenance

Solar systems have no moving parts and require minimal maintenance. With professional installation, commercial solar panels can last 25+ years.


Choosing the Right Commercial Solar Installers

To maximise the benefits of commercial solar, it's essential to choose experienced and accredited commercial solar installers. Here's what to look for:

  • CEC Accreditation: Ensure your installer is approved by the Clean Energy Council.
  • Tailored Solutions: Your provider should analyse your energy needs and design a system accordingly.
  • Commercial Experience: Choose a company with a portfolio of successful commercial projects in Sydney.
  • Performance Monitoring: Ask about tools for real-time system monitoring and performance reporting.
  • Warranty Support: Look for solid panel, inverter, and workmanship warranties.

A professional installer will also manage grid connection approval, permits, safety inspections, and any rebate paperwork.


How Commercial Solar Installation Works

Here’s a general overview of the commercial solar installation process:

  1. Site Assessment & Energy Audit: Installers evaluate your roof space, electricity usage, and shading issues.
  2. System Design: A custom solution is designed based on your business’s energy profile and goals.
  3. Approval & Permits: Installers handle all regulatory approvals and applications for incentives.
  4. Installation: Panels, inverters, and mounting systems are installed with minimal disruption to your operations.
  5. Connection & Activation: Once approved, your system is connected to the grid, and you begin generating clean power.
